NRW.Innovationspartner was a regional joint project to strengthen the innovative capacity of small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) in particular.
The state of North Rhine-Westphalia supported the nine economic regions of the state in expanding the already existing regional structures of innovation management, funding advice and technology transfer. By creating a regionally and technically differentiated advisory and support system, already established structures were strengthened and made more easily accessible to SMEs.
Together with its partners, Münsterland e.V. created a central information architecture for innovation consulting and conducted training for innovation consultants in the region.
NRW.Innovationspartner in Münsterland was supported by a central back-office, which was located at NRW.Bank. The back office provided knowledge on funding programmes for all regions, developed qualification measures and tools for innovation consulting and networked the regions.
